基于时间序列的性能分析算法.docxVIP

  • 1
  • 0
  • 约1.64万字
  • 约 27页
  • 2025-12-30 发布于上海
  • 举报

PAGE1/NUMPAGES1

基于时间序列的性能分析算法

TOC\o1-3\h\z\u

第一部分时间序列数据预处理方法 2

第二部分算法模型选择与优化 5

第三部分性能评估指标体系 8

第四部分算法收敛性分析 12

第五部分多源数据融合技术 15

第六部分网络延迟影响研究 18

第七部分实时性与准确性平衡 21

第八部分算法应用场景拓展 24

第一部分时间序列数据预处理方法

关键词

关键要点

时间序列数据清洗与缺失值处理

1.基于统计方法的缺失值填补,如插值法、均值填补、线性回归填补等,适用于数据完整性较高场景。

2.采用异常值检测方法,如Z-score、IQR(四分位距)检测,剔除明显异常数据点。

3.结合生成模型生成缺失数据,提升数据质量与模型鲁棒性,尤其适用于高维复杂时间序列。

时间序列特征提取与维度降维

1.利用时序特征提取方法,如滑动窗口统计量、傅里叶变换、小波分析等,提取有效特征。

2.应用降维技术,如PCA、t-SNE、UMAP,减少冗余信息,提升模型训练效率。

3.结合生成模型生成特征,增强数据多样性,提升模型泛化能力。

时间序列对齐与时间窗口处理

1.采用时间对齐方法,如时间偏移、时间戳对齐,确保不同数据源时间一致性。

2.应用滑动窗口技术,提取时间序列的局部特征,适用于时序预测与分析。

3.结合生成模型生成时间窗口数据,增强数据多样性,提升模型适应性。

时间序列分类与异常检测

1.利用监督与无监督学习方法,构建分类模型,区分正常与异常时间序列。

2.应用生成对抗网络(GAN)生成异常样本,提升模型检测能力。

3.结合深度学习模型,如LSTM、Transformer,实现高精度异常检测。

时间序列预测模型优化

1.采用生成模型,如GAN、VAE,生成潜在空间数据,提升预测精度。

2.应用自适应时间序列预测模型,动态调整模型参数,适应不同场景需求。

3.结合生成模型与传统模型,构建混合预测框架,提升预测稳定性与泛化能力。

时间序列数据可视化与分析

1.利用时序图、热力图、折线图等可视化方法,直观展示时间序列趋势与模式。

2.应用机器学习模型进行时间序列分析,如ARIMA、SARIMA、Prophet等。

3.结合生成模型生成可视化数据,提升分析效率与可解释性。

时间序列数据预处理是构建有效时间序列分析模型的基础环节,其目的在于消除数据中的噪声、缺失值以及非线性特征,从而提升后续分析的准确性与稳定性。在《基于时间序列的性能分析算法》一文中,对时间序列数据预处理方法进行了系统性阐述,涵盖了数据清洗、特征提取、标准化与归一化、缺失值处理、异常值检测与处理等多个方面,旨在为后续的时间序列建模与分析提供坚实的数据基础。

首先,数据清洗是时间序列预处理的核心步骤之一。时间序列数据通常来源于多种传感器、金融系统或工业设备,其采集过程中可能存在数据采集误差、设备故障或环境干扰等导致的数据异常。因此,数据清洗旨在识别并修正这些异常值,以确保数据的完整性与准确性。常见的数据清洗方法包括均值修正、中位数修正、移动平均法及小波变换等。例如,采用移动平均法可以有效平滑数据中的短期波动,而小波变换则适用于非平稳数据的去噪处理,能够保留数据的时频特征。此外,对于缺失值的处理,通常采用插值法(如线性插值、多项式插值)或删除法(如删除缺失值所在的观测点)。在实际应用中,需根据数据特性选择合适的处理策略,以避免因数据缺失导致模型性能下降。

其次,特征提取是时间序列预处理的另一重要环节。时间序列数据通常具有时序依赖性,其特征可包括趋势、周期性、季节性、异方差性等。特征提取方法主要包括统计特征提取与时频域分析。统计特征如均值、方差、标准差、最大值、最小值等,能够反映数据的基本分布特性;而时频域分析则通过傅里叶变换、小波变换等方法,将时间序列转换为时频域表示,从而提取出数据中的周期性与变化趋势。例如,小波变换能够有效捕捉时间序列中的局部特征,适用于非平稳数据的分析。此外,基于机器学习的时间序列特征提取方法,如自编码器(Autoencoder)与卷积神经网络(CNN),也被广泛应用于特征提取任务中,能够自动学习数据的潜在结构,提升模型的泛化能力。

第三,标准化与归一化是时间序列预处理中的关键步骤,旨在消除不同尺度对模型的影响。时间序列数据通常具有不同的量纲与分布特性,若未进行标准化处理,可能导致模型对某些特征赋予过大的权重,从而影响模型的收敛速度与性能。常见的标准化方法包括Z-score标准化与Min-Ma

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档